ITG is coming up with an electrochemical NO/NO2 sensor line
that will meet all requirements for automotive exhaust gas
measurement (TEDDIE study) and also for treatment of
hypoxic respiratory failures in the medical area.
In both applications the exact discrimination of both gas
constituents at low ppm levels within seconds is required.
